Medical Abortion: A Detailed Guide
Medical procedure offers a safe alternative to surgical removal for ending a pregnancy. This process typically involves taking two medications, mifepristone and misoprostol, to stop the pregnancy's development . It's crucial to understand the entire journey, including potential impacts, follow-up care , and suitable timing. This guide offers a comprehensive overview of the stages involved, along with key information regarding eligibility and what to expect during the experience . Always consult a qualified healthcare provider before considering this choice .

The Risks and Realities of Abortion Pills Online
Acquiring drugs for abortion termination via the web presents considerable risks and a challenging reality. While accessibility is often advertised , patients may encounter substandard products, leading to incomplete abortions with severe complications such as excessive bleeding, infection , and undetected ectopic pregnancies. Moreover, obtaining these compounds without a direct examination by a healthcare professional may mask underlying health conditions and prevent appropriate counseling . The status of online abortion services also differs widely, creating legal ambiguity and obstructing access to essential follow-up assistance. Therefore, relying on unregulated sources for abortion treatment can jeopardize both physical and mental well-being.

Understanding the Legalities of Abortion Pill Delivery
Navigating the challenging landscape of abortion pill delivery requires a detailed understanding of the shifting regulatory framework. Currently, national laws interact with local restrictions, creating a patchwork system. Initially, the FDA approved medication abortion through a restricted program, necessitating a encounter with a physician and a order. However, recent changes have allowed for increased access via post and pharmacy settings, although these advancements are influenced by ongoing court battles and potential upcoming legislation. Key considerations include compliance with the Comstock Act, which exists a likely impediment to certain shipping methods, and the diverse criteria established by individual jurisdictions. Therefore, clinics and women involved in this method must stay aware about the present legal situation.
